    Legal analysis: camphor trees cannot be cut down, which is considered a crime. Camphor is a national key protected wild plant.

    Illegal felling of camphor trees violates the crime of illegal logging and destruction of national key protected plants. Whoever violates state regulations by illegally felling or destroying precious trees or other plants under key national protection, or illegally purchasing, transporting, processing, or purchasing precious trees or other plants under key national protection and the products thereof, shall be sentenced to up to three years imprisonment, short-term detention or controlled release, and shall also be fined; where the circumstances are serious, the sentence is between three and seven years imprisonment and a concurrent fine.

    Legal basis: Article 344 of the Criminal Law of the People's Republic of China [Crime of Illegal Felling and Destruction of Plants under National Key Protection] [Crime of Illegal Acquisition, Transportation, Processing, Illegal Harvesting or Destruction of Precious Trees or Other Plants under National Key Protection] Violating State regulations by illegally felling or destroying precious trees or other plants under national key protection.

    or illegally acquire, transport, process, or process precious trees or other plants under national key protection and the products thereof, shall be sentenced to up to three years imprisonment, short-term detention or controlled release, and shall also be fined; where the circumstances are serious, the sentence is between three and seven years imprisonment and a concurrent fine.

    Legal analysis: Wild camphor trees are national second-class protected tree species, and it is illegal to cut down camphor trees without permission.

    Legal basis: Criminal Law of the People's Republic of China Article 345 Whoever illegally logs down forests or other forest trees, and the quantity is relatively large, shall be sentenced to fixed-term imprisonment of not more than three years, short-term detention or controlled release, and/or a fine; where the amount is huge, a sentence of between three and seven years imprisonment and a concurrent fine is to be given; where the amount is especially huge, a sentence of seven or more years imprisonment and a concurrent fine is to be given. Whoever violates the provisions of the Forest Law by indiscriminately felling forests or other forest trees, and the quantity is relatively large, shall be sentenced to fixed-term imprisonment of not more than three years, short-term detention or control of the mill, and/or a fine; where the amount is huge, a sentence of between three and seven years imprisonment and a concurrent fine is to be given;

    Illegally acquiring or transporting illegally or indiscriminately felled forest trees Illegally purchasing or transporting illegally or indiscriminately felled forest trees, where the circumstances are serious, is to be sentenced to up to three years imprisonment, short-term detention or controlled release, and/or a fine; where the circumstances are particularly pure and serious, the sentence is between three and seven years imprisonment and a concurrent fine. Those who illegally or indiscriminately cut down forests or other trees in national nature reserves shall be given heavier punishments.

    Legal Analysis: It is not illegal to cut down artificially planted camphor trees, but if you cut down wild camphor trees, you may be suspected of illegal logging and will be criminally filed.

    Legal basis: "Provisions of the Supreme People's Procuratorate and the Ministry of Public Security on the Standards for Filing and Prosecution of Criminal Cases under the Jurisdiction of Public Security Organs (1)" Article 72: Where illegal logging of forests or other trees is suspected of any of the following circumstances, a case shall be filed for prosecution:

    1) Illegal logging of 2 to 5 cubic meters or more;

    2) Illegally felling 100 to 200 or more young trees.

    In any of the following circumstances for the purpose of illegal occupation, it is "illegal felling of forests or other forests" as provided for in this article;

    1) Cutting down forests or other forests owned by the State, collectives, others, or contracted management by others without authorization;

    2) Cutting down forests or other forests contracted by the unit or by oneself without authorization;

    3) Felling forests or other forest trees owned by the State, collectives, others or contracted management by others outside the locations specified in the forest felling permit.
